One of the biggest threats to commercial property protection is unauthorized access. Many modern office buildings have multiple entrances, shared workspaces, visitor areas, and delivery zones. Without proper monitoring, unauthorized individuals can enter facilities unnoticed.
Common Entry Points
| Vulnerable Area | Risk Level |
| Main Lobby | Moderate |
| Loading Docks | High |
| Parking Garages | High |
| Emergency Exits | High |
| Shared Building Entrances | Moderate |
According to an assessment by the International Foundation for Protection Officers, many instances of workplace security breaches often start with a violation of access rights to restricted areas of the workplace.
Office building security guards employed in California can ensure that visitor check-ins and verification take place, as well as surveillance of vulnerable access points.

Damaging property is called vandalism, and commercial buildings are usually the target, especially at night, on the weekends, or during holidays.

Many businesses have a closed-circuit television system or security personnel at the entrance; however, most do not focus on their parking area; therefore, they are very vulnerable.
Because of the lack of monitoring in a parking lot, due to the lower traffic during off-hours, these have a higher incidence of criminal activity.
Common incidents are:
According to the Bureau of Justice Statistics, parking lots and garages are some of the highest areas for violent crime. Facility services offer various solutions to secure parking lots, including patrols, access controls, and surveillance monitoring to reduce risks.

For instance, a warehouse operation in California regularly had inventory shortages despite an extensive plan for external security. With an internal investigation, it was determined that the inventory shortages were occurring because of a former employee who had an unauthorized key to the building.
